This is the process of printing a changing field on a static background. Most commonly, a design will be set up with a blank field where a unique name or message can be inserted in different fonts or colors.\u00a0It is also a great technique for creating custom cards and coupon codes.<\/p>\n<p>More and more companies are realizing that personalizing a mailing or a printed piece will generate\u00a0both a higher\u00a0read-through rate and more\u00a0interaction with their audience. We see the same techniques with e-mail blasts, where the subscriber&#8217;s first name will be inserted into the email instead of a generic &#8220;Hello&#8221; or &#8220;Greetings&#8221;.<\/p>\n<p>Variable Data doesn&#8217;t only have to be used for personalizing names and addresses. Coca-Cola&#8217;s Share a Coke\u00ae Campaign<\/h3>\n<figure id=\"attachment_4104\" a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-4104\" style=\"width: 377px\" class=\"wp-caption alignleft\"><img fetchpriority=\"high\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"  wp-image-4104\" src=\"http:\/\/mmprint.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2015\/07\/hp_coca-cola_3-900x600.jpg\" alt=\"variable data labels\" width=\"377\" height=\"251\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.mmprint.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2015\/07\/hp_coca-cola_3.jpg 900w, https:\/\/www.mmprint.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2015\/07\/hp_coca-cola_3-300x200.jpg 300w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 377px) 100vw, 377px\" \/><figcaption id=\"caption-attachment-4104\" class=\"wp-caption-text\">Photo From &#8211; http:\/\/goo.gl\/1ZYNAW<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p>For the first time in ten years, Coca Cola have increased their sales. This is likely due to a clever marketing campaign utilized\u00a0variable data. Starting in the summer of 2014 (in the U.S.) Coke began printing labels with the phrase &#8220;Share a Coke with&#8230;&#8221; and 150 variable names imprinted on the labels. These personalized labels act as a unique call to action, urging customers to not only buy the product, but also to create a second interaction by gifting (sharing) it with someone else.<\/p>\n<p>Even further than this consumer-company interaction, the Share a Coke\u00a0campaign has fostered interaction\u00a0on social media through image posts and shares. This increased user created content and produced\u00a0even more exposure for coke products and their brand. By using variable data on their labels, Coke was able to not only increase sales, but also generated\u00a0consumer interaction with their company and brand.<\/p>\n<h3>2. Variable Data Coupons<\/h3>\n<figure id=\"attachment_4110\" a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-4110\" style=\"width: 404px\" class=\"wp-caption alignright\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"  wp-image-4110\" src=\"http:\/\/mmprint.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2015\/07\/variable-coupons.jpg\" alt=\"variable data coupons\" width=\"404\" height=\"269\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.mmprint.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2015\/07\/variable-coupons.jpg 600w, https:\/\/www.mmprint.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2015\/07\/variable-coupons-300x200.jpg 300w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 404px) 100vw, 404px\" \/><figcaption id=\"caption-attachment-4110\" class=\"wp-caption-text\">Photo From &#8211; http:\/\/goo.gl\/CWULKQ<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p>Customer&#8217;s love to receive coupons, especially from places they frequently visit. Coupons are also a great way to drive new business in, or keep customers coming back for more.\u00a0One way to make customers even more excited about receiving a coupon in the mail is to make that coupon personalized exactly for that shopper.<\/p>\n<p>This can be done in two ways. First, coupons can be personalized with the\u00a0customer&#8217;s name using prospective shoppers or previous shoppers. The otheroption would be to cross sell products and services to customers based on their shopping history.<\/p>\n<div>\n<div class=\"su-note\"  style=\"border-color:#b3b3b3;border-radius:5px;-moz-border-radius:5px;-webkit-border-radius:5px;\"><div class=\"su-note-inner su-u-clearfix su-u-trim\" style=\"background-color:#cdcdcd;border-color:#ffffff;color:#333333;border-radius:5px;-moz-border-radius:5px;-webkit-border-radius:5px;\">For Example:<\/p>\n<p>Somebody just bought a bicycle? Send them a personalized coupon for a new helmet. Another customer just bought a new snowboard? How about a discount off your store&#8217;s next ski outing!<\/div><\/div>\n<\/div>\n<h3>3.
